Home Tags Disney+

Tag: Disney+

“Iwájú”, an original animated series set in a futuristic Lagos, Nigeria...

0
...Kugali filmmakers—including director Olufikayo Ziki Adeola, production designer Hamid Ibrahim and cultural consultant Toluwalakin Olowofoyeku—take viewers on a unique journey into the world of...